Output d8102062edc2c99c719edf22b7eb76bf8c05c143e0de706d0ae69cb391317922:1

value
2788526
script pubkey
OP_0 OP_PUSHBYTES_20 9649768e4b85366f4fb26bf5e104c6a9d7338eab
address
bc1qjeyhdrjts5mx7najd067zpxx48tn8r4tfdh2t9
transaction
d8102062edc2c99c719edf22b7eb76bf8c05c143e0de706d0ae69cb391317922
spent
true